Output 00f43a47dbbc8024e76b7321eb8e3162f57c1a2ef0f7f942a46c56acd050cdaa:17

value
409859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f80cc217e692c3844c550be5dd668838795ce3b OP_EQUAL
address
3K9bHBYdvWbR44c938BXpWameUNuRZE2PL
transaction
00f43a47dbbc8024e76b7321eb8e3162f57c1a2ef0f7f942a46c56acd050cdaa
spent
true